Optimization of speeded-up robust feature algorithm for hardware implementation

被引:0
|
作者
CAI ShanShan [1 ]
LIU LeiBo [1 ]
YIN ShouYi [1 ]
ZHOU RenYan [1 ]
ZHANG WeiLong [1 ]
WEI ShaoJun [1 ]
机构
[1] Institute of Micro-Electronics and the National Laboratory for Information Science and Technology,Tsinghua University
基金
中国国家自然科学基金;
关键词
SURF; feature detection; optimization scheme;
D O I
暂无
中图分类号
TP301.6 [算法理论];
学科分类号
081202 ;
摘要
Speeded-Up Robust Feature(SURF)is a widely-used robust local gradient feature detection and description algorithm.The algorithm itself can be implemented easily on general-purpose processors.However,the software implementation of SURF cannot achieve a performance high enough to meet the practical real-time requirements.And what is more,the huge data storage and the floating point operation of SURF algorithm make it hard and onerous to design and verify corresponding hardware implementation.This paper customized a SURF algorithm for hardware implementation,which combined several optimization methods in previous literature and three approaches(named Word Length Reduction(WLR),Low Bits Abandon(LBA),and Sampling Radius Reduction(SRR)).The computation operations of the simplified and optimized SURF(P-SURF)were reduced by 50%compared with the original SURF.At the same time,the Recall and Precision of the SURF feature descriptor are only dropped by 0.31 on average in the typical testing set,which are within an acceptable accuracy range.P-SURF has been implemented on hardware using TSMC 65 nm process,and the architecture of the whole system mainly contains four modules,including Integral Image Generator,IPoint Detector,IPoint Orientation Assigner,and IPoint Feature Vector Extractor.The chip size is 3.4×4 mm2.The power usage is less than 220mW according to the Synopsys Prime time while extracting IPoints in a video input of VGA(640×480)172 fps operating at 200 MHz.The performance is better than the results reported in literature.
引用
收藏
页码:258 / 272
页数:15
相关论文
共 50 条
  • [31] Speeded-up, relaxed spatial matching
    Tolias, Giorgos
    Avrithis, Yannis
    2011 IEEE INTERNATIONAL CONFERENCE ON COMPUTER VISION (ICCV), 2011, : 1653 - 1660
  • [32] Improvement of speeded-up robust features for robot visual simultaneous localization and mapping
    Wang, Yin-Tien
    Lin, Guan-Yu
    ROBOTICA, 2014, 32 (04) : 533 - 549
  • [33] ISAR image scattering center association based on speeded-up robust features
    Di, Guohui
    Su, Fulin
    Yang, Hongxin
    Fu, Shuang
    MULTIMEDIA TOOLS AND APPLICATIONS, 2020, 79 (7-8) : 5065 - 5082
  • [34] Face Antispoofing Using Speeded-Up Robust Features and Fisher Vector Encoding
    Boulkenafet, Zinelabidine
    Komulainen, Jukka
    Hadid, Abdenour
    IEEE SIGNAL PROCESSING LETTERS, 2017, 24 (02) : 141 - 145
  • [35] Speeded-Up Robust Features Based Moving Object Detection on Shaky Video
    Zhou, Minqi
    Asari, Vijayan K.
    COMPUTER NETWORKS AND INTELLIGENT COMPUTING, 2011, 157 : 677 - +
  • [36] Feature-Learning-Based Printed Circuit Board Inspection via Speeded-Up Robust Features and Random Forest
    Yuk, Eun Hye
    Park, Seung Hwan
    Park, Cheong-Sool
    Baek, Jun-Geol
    APPLIED SCIENCES-BASEL, 2018, 8 (06):
  • [37] Enhancing Static Biometric Signature Verification Using Speeded-Up Robust Features
    Guest, Richard
    Miguel-Hurtado, Oscar
    46TH ANNUAL 2012 IEEE INTERNATIONAL CARNAHAN CONFERENCE ON SECURITY TECHNOLOGY, 2012, : 213 - 217
  • [38] AN APPROACH FOR X-RAY IMAGE MOSAICING BASED ON SPEEDED-UP ROBUST FEATURES
    Gong, Jun-Hui
    Zhang, Jun-Hua
    An, Zhen-Zhou
    Zhao, Wei-Wei
    Liu, Hui-Min
    2012 INTERNATIONAL CONFERENCE ON WAVELET ACTIVE MEDIA TECHNOLOGY AND INFORMATION PROCESSING (LCWAMTIP), 2012, : 432 - 435
  • [39] COMBINING SPEEDED-UP ROBUST FEATURES WITH PRINCIPAL COMPONENT ANALYSIS IN FACE RECOGNITION SYSTEM
    Lin, Shinfeng D.
    Liu, Bo-Feng
    Lin, Jia-Hong
    INTERNATIONAL JOURNAL OF INNOVATIVE COMPUTING INFORMATION AND CONTROL, 2012, 8 (12): : 8545 - 8556
  • [40] Offline Language-free Writer Identification Based on Speeded-up Robust Features
    Sharma, M. K.
    Dhaka, V. P.
    INTERNATIONAL JOURNAL OF ENGINEERING, 2015, 28 (07): : 984 - 994